What year did Corvette have a 427 engine?

The first 427-powered Corvette rolled off the assembly line for the 1966 model year. Two performance levels of the 427 were initially offered – an “L30” version rated at 390 horsepower and the “L72,” which cranked out 425 horsepower. Both were rated at 460 lb-ft.

How much horsepower does a Ford 390 have?

The 390 cu in (6.4 L) 2v is rated at 265 bhp (197.6 kW) @ 4,100 rpm, while the 4v version was rated at 320 bhp (238.6 kW) @ 4,100 rpm in certain applications. Certain 1967 & 68 Mustangs had 390 4v engines rated at 335 horsepower (250 kW), as did some Fairlane GTs and S code Mercury Cougars.

How much horsepower does a GT40 make?

The GT40 Mk 1 used a 4.7 liter (289 cubic inch) based on that of the Ford Mustang. Exact numbers vary, but this engine made approximately 350 horsepower in race trim. In the road-going GT40 Mk III, the 4.7 V8 was detuned to 335 horsepower. The GT40 Mk II was powered by a big-block 7.0 liter (427 cubic inch) V8 borrowed from the Ford Galaxie.

What is the history of the Ford GT40?

The name “GT40” was the name of Ford’s project to prepare the cars for the international endurance racing circuit, and the quest to win the 24 Hours of Le Mans. What kind of engine does a GT40 Mk II have?

Ford GT40 Mk II rear The Mk.II was rebuilt by Holman Moody in California to handle the 7.0-liter FE (427 ci) engine from the Ford Galaxie, used in NASCAR at the time and modified for road course use.

How much horsepower does a 2020 GT40 have?

660
What’s New for 2020? Ford squeezes even more horsepower from the GT’s twin-turbo V-6 for 2020. The rise from 647 ponies to 660 is accompanied by a fatter torque curve, recalibrated engine management, and revised pistons and ignition coils.

How much horsepower does a 429 Cobra Jet engine have?

429 Cobra Jet Performance Specs The power of this engine made it very popular for performance enthusiasts. The 429 Cobra Jet was advertised as having 370 horsepower at 5400 RPM and 450 lbs-ft of torque at 3400 RPM.

What kind of engine does a GT40 have?

The GT40 is a purpose-built road-race car, with a mid-engined semi-monococque chassis that measures forty inches high at the windshield, giving the car its name. Several versions of the original GT40 were built, powered by a variety of V8 engines. The GT40 Mk 1 used a 4.7 liter (289 cubic inch) based on that of the Ford Mustang.

How did the GT40 change over time?

The changes continued as lighter weight fiberglass replaced heavier aluminum and steel, and wider magnesium wheels replaced the wire spoke version along with a hundred other modifications. Suddenly the GT40 began to not only look like a racing car, but to perform like one.
